The Kilpi cross-country ski camp #1

05. 01. 2019

The first Kilpi cross-country skiing camp went well. On Friday, 28th December, 8 enthusiastic people (2 girls, 3 women and 3 men), who wanted to improve their cross-country skiing, met at the Černohorský Express cable car. To begin with, they received the "Kilpi-MaChr" package, comprising of a cravat, headband and tickets for the cable car.

All participants chose the classical style. In the morning, general training in skiing was in progress. It is necessary for a person to learn how to stand on skis. He or she got used to sliding on the skis (our brain perceives skidding and sliding as a potential danger and subconsciously refuses to do it, so we have to persuade the CNS that there is nothing to fear). This practice included a lot of fun within a game format and simple and safe downhill skiing. Games break the psychological barrier to our shyness.

At lunchtime, besides a short lecture on cross-country ski wax, we discussed training, food and nutrition and just about life. I am convinced that if one feels that the instructor does not have an interest in him or her, then teaching is not so effective. Yes, an individual approach comes first.

After lunch, we had to wax our skis and used a red klister on the wet snow. We set out boldly on the ski track. The camp participants made great progress and 2 hours of skiing in the afternoon passed in no time. And everyone was looking forward to the next day.

On Saturday, the Guardian, Rübezahl, sent us moist snow, which is a nightmare of many professional servicemen. "To hit" the right wax was difficult and we had to fix it a few times. All participants acquit themselves well and despite the noticeable fatigue, they made progress. Experienced skiers were looking for lesser nuances in technique, less experienced tried real skiing stances.

At lunch, the participants saw themselves on video and got feedback from their instructor. In the afternoon, we set out in the vast and spiky terrain of the Černá hora mountain and took a short trip to practice the style we have just learnt. Most participants are going to Jizerská 50, so we perhaps helped them to run their race in as short a time period as possible!

The first course is behind us, but the other three ones are ahead of us.
